CVE-2011-4295 in moodleinfo

Summary

by MITRE

The moodle_enrol_external:role_assign function in enrol/externallib.php in Moodle 2.0.x before 2.0.4 and 2.1.x before 2.1.1 does not have an authorization check, which allows remote authenticated users to gain privileges by making a role assignment.

The vulnerability described in CVE-2011-4295 represents a critical authorization flaw within the Moodle learning management system that affects versions prior to 2.0.4 and 2.1.1. This issue resides in the moodle_enrol_external:role_assign function located within the enrol/externallib.php file, which serves as a critical component for external enrollment operations. The flaw stems from the absence of proper access control verification mechanisms that should validate whether authenticated users possess sufficient privileges to perform role assignment operations within the system. This oversight creates a significant security gap that can be exploited by malicious actors who have already gained authentication credentials to the platform.

The technical implementation of this vulnerability demonstrates a failure in the principle of least privilege enforcement within the Moodle authorization framework. When users authenticate to the system, they should only be granted permissions appropriate to their roles and capabilities. However, the absence of authorization checks in the external enrollment library means that any authenticated user can potentially manipulate role assignments regardless of their actual permissions. This flaw operates at the application logic level and constitutes a direct violation of proper access control mechanisms as defined by the Common Weakness Enumeration standard under CWE-284 which addresses improper access control vulnerabilities.

The operational impact of this vulnerability extends far beyond simple privilege escalation as it enables attackers to fundamentally alter the security posture of the entire Moodle installation. An authenticated attacker could assign administrative roles to themselves or other users, effectively bypassing the intended role-based access controls that protect sensitive system functions and data. This capability allows for complete compromise of the learning management system, enabling unauthorized modifications to course content, user management, system configurations, and potentially leading to data breaches or complete system takeover. The vulnerability particularly affects organizations relying on Moodle for educational content management where unauthorized access to administrative functions could result in significant educational and security consequences.

Security professionals should implement immediate mitigations including upgrading to the patched versions of Moodle 2.0.4 and 2.1.1 as recommended by the vendor.
